Pecan Pie Muffins

These delicious Pecan Pie Muffins combine the rich flavors of classic pecan pie in a convenient muffin form. Perfect for breakfast or as an indulgent snack, these muffins are sweet, nutty, and oh-so-satisfying.

Ingredients
  

  • 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up brown sugar, packed
  • ½ c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• ½ teaspoon baking soda
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 2 large eggs
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up buttermilk
  • 1 cup pecans, chopped You can substitute with walnuts or other nuts if desired.

Instructions
 

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ease the muffin tin or line it with muffin liners.
  • In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, brown sugar, granulated sugar,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and ground cinnamon until well combined.
  • In a separate bowl, beat the eggs, then whisk in the melted butter, vanilla extract, and buttermilk until smooth.
  •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and mix just until combined. Be careful not to overmix; a few lumps are okay.
  • Gently fold in the chopped pecans.
  • Fill each muffin cup about ¾ full with the batter.
  • Bake in the preheated oven for 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  • Allow the muffins to cool in the tin for about 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Notes

Store the muffins in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days, or refrigerate for up to a week.
You can substitute the pecans with walnuts or other nuts if desired.
To elevate the flavor, consider adding a touch of maple syrup to the wet ingredients.
For extra sweetness, drizzle with a simple glaze made of powdered sugar and milk after baking. Enjoy your tasty pecan pie muffins!
